Ukraine Under Attack: Lviv Targeted by Russian Air Raids

Lviv was the target of Russian air raids that night, resulting in the loss of at least seven lives and injuring at least 38 people, according to Mayor Andrij Sadowyj. Tragically, three of the deceased were children. A residential building in the center near the train station caught fire, causing widespread destruction.

Ukrainian Parliament Accepts Minister Resignations

The Ukrainian parliament has accepted the resignations of four ministers, according to the Chamber of Deputies. However, Foreign Minister Dmytro Kuleba’s request for resignation was not heeded, and is expected to be finalized on Thursday.

President Zelenskyj Seeks to Reorganize Government

The President of Ukraine, Volodymyr Zelenskyj, aims to give his country an energy boost through a comprehensive reorganization of the government. “We need new energy,” Zelenskyy responded to a question about the reasons for the government reshuffle. “And these steps are linked to strengthening our condition in various areas.” Ukraine has been defending itself against Russia’s war of aggression for two and a half years.

Government Reshuffle: Multiple Ministers Resign

On Tuesday night, the leader of the parliamentary group of the Servant of the People party that controls Ukraine, David Arachamia, announced that at least six representatives of the government had submitted their resignations. They include the ministers of strategic industries, justice, and environmental protection. Arachamia announced a “day of dismissal” for Wednesday. In the morning, it was announced that the Foreign Minister of Ukraine, Dmytro Kuleba, was also resigning from his post.

German Foreign Minister Pays Tribute to Dmytro Kuleba

Federal Foreign Minister Annalena Baerbock paid tribute to her Ukrainian colleague, Dmytro Kuleba. “Long talks on night trains, in the G7, on the front line, in Brussels, in front of a bombed power station,” wrote politician Green on X.

“Few people I’ve worked with as closely as you,” she adds. “You put the people of your country above yourself.” She wishes Kuleba the best “from the bottom of my heart – we should meet again when peace and freedom have returned to the whole of Ukraine.”
